This is an old post of mine, which may give you an indication what that horrible place was like.

In round 20 of 1982, my Demon mate and I went to Victoria Park for the first (and last) time to watch Melbourne play Collingwood.ย  We found standing room in a packed outer but soon realised we were surrounded by a seething mob of dirty, ugly, loud, abusive, obscene, smelly and toothless black and white supporters.ย  Almost without exception, they were drunk, smoking like chimneys, swearing like wharfies and even at this early stage of the day fighting amongst themselves.ย  Rather than relinquish their spot in the crowd, they were peeing where they stood.ย  Some of the men were just as bad.

We started well with the wind but the Pies had regained the lead by half-time.ย  The third quarter was all ours with eight goals and in the last, we kicked another eight to finish all over them by nine goals.ย  Glenn McLean was magnificent that day, marking everything in sight and earning the three Brownlow votes.ย  Collingwood were so impressed that they traded for him and you will rapt to hear that Glenn went on to have a wonderful two-game career with the Pies.

Having kept very, very quiet all day for fear of attracting the wrong sort of attention, the beers (ice-cold cans!) finally got the better of me and this is when I did the craziest thing in my life.ย ย As Mark 'Jacko' Jackson kicked his seventh to seal victory, I let rip with a loud "Go Demons!!".ย  Things then went eerily quiet in the outer as hundreds of pairs of beady eyes bored into us.ย  I looked at my mate, he nodded and we turned and ran as fast as we could towards the exit and kept going all the way to Johnstone Street where we jumped on the first bus we found.ย  It didn't matter that it was heading in the wrong direction, we just wanted to get away from that horrible joint.ย  Only my drycleaner will know just how frightened I was that day.
